2,147,527,844 is a composite number, even.
2,147,527,844 (two billion one hundred forty-seven million five hundred twenty-seven thousand eight hundred forty-four) is an even 10-digit number. It is a composite number with 72 divisors, and factors as 2² × 7 × 11² × 43 × 14,741. Its proper divisors sum to 2,683,602,460,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x8000ACA4.
